Ford Transit 2.4 Diesel ECU and Fuel System Troubleshooting
Diagnosing problems with the Ford Transit's 2.4-liter diesel engine can be a challenging task. The Electronic Control Unit (ECU) and fuel system are complex, intertwined components responsible for optimal performance and emissions control. Common issues include lack of power, engine misfires, and warning indicators.
- Before diving into complex repairs, begin with the basics. Inspect fluid levels for any signs of damage or wear.
- Verify proper fuel flow as clogged filters or faulty pumps can significantly impact performance.
- If problems continue, utilize a scan tool to read diagnostic trouble codes (DTCs). These codes provide valuable insights into the specific issue.
Consult a qualified mechanic for further diagnosis and repairs. Attempting complex ECU or fuel system modifications without proper knowledge can lead to further damage.

Decoding Ford Transit 2.2 Engine Codes with a Code Reader Kit
When your Ford Transit 2.2 engine starts acting up, faltering, a code reader kit can be your best friend. These handy devices allow you to read the engine's trouble codes, giving you valuable insights about what might be causing the problem.
Understanding these codes can feel challenging, but with a little guidance, you can become a master of Ford Transit diagnostics.
- A code reader kit typically consists of a handheld scanner and a cable that connects to your vehicle's OBD-II port.
- Upon connecting the device and turning on your ignition, the device will fetch the stored trouble codes from your engine control unit (ECU).
- Specific code corresponds to a particular issue, ranging from trivial sensor problems to more serious engine malfunctions.
With the trouble codes in hand, you can then consult a repair manual or online database to pinpoint the exact cause of the problem. This can save you time and dollars by allowing you to address the issue directly rather than speculating.
